Position Overview
The Senior Associate, Investments supports the investment team in sourcing, analyzing, and executing investment opportunities. The role combines financial modeling, market research, due diligence, and portfolio monitoring to help drive investment decisions.
Senior Associates work closely with Vice Presidents, Directors, and other senior investment professionals, contributing to deal execution and portfolio management while developing their analytical and strategic skills.
Key Responsibilities
Conduct detailed financial analysis, including modeling, valuation, and scenario analysis for potential investments
Support due diligence, including market research, competitive analysis, and operational assessments
Assist in structuring and executing transactions, including documentation and coordination with legal and compliance teams
Monitor portfolio company or asset performance, including financial reporting, key metrics, and risk monitoring
Prepare investment memos, presentation decks, and updates for senior management and investment committees
Collaborate with internal teams and external advisors to ensure accurate and timely execution of investment initiatives
Identify trends, opportunities, and risks to inform investment strategy and decision-making
Preferred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Economics, Accounting, or a related field; CFA or MBA is a plus
2–5 years of relevant investment experience (private equity, credit, growth equity, or other alternative investments)
Strong financial modeling, valuation, and analytical skills
Experience supporting deal execution and due diligence processes
Excellent written and verbal communication skills; strong attention to detail
Ability to manage multiple projects and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ment
Proficiency in Excel; familiarity with SQL, Python, or portfolio management tools is a plus
